God Gave You A Free Will
God has committed Himself to honoring our decisions; He is determined to maintain our God-given freedom of will. So, when we insist on doing things the way WE feel would be best for us, He allows us to go ahead and make our own decisions. These human decisions lead us into tough situations where the temptation to do wrong is strong.


Learning The Hard Way
James 1:13-14 (NIV) When tempted, no one should say, “God is tempting me.” For God cannot be tempted by evil, nor does he tempt anyone; but each one is tempted WHEN, by his own evil desire, he is dragged away and enticed. God, Himself, will never tempt us to do wrong; however, He will allow us to go our own way for a time. During this time, we will experience temptations to do wrong things. We will be allowed to see what it is like to start running our own life again. This helps us see how important it is for us to allow God to do His will in our earthly life like it is done in heaven.
Temptation
We Are ALL Tempted
The temptation to do wrong or evil things is strong inside us. Addictive pleasure comes our way, when we yield to temptation. God has healed your desire so you now “want” to do good to and for yourself and other people; however, your body still has a desire of its own. The Bible explains it this way in Romans 7:22-23: For in my inner being I delight in God’s law; but I see another law at work in the members of my body, waging war against the law of my mind and making me a prisoner of the law of sin at work within my members. Your inner being is the real you; you ARE a spirit being, you LIVE IN a body, and you HAVE a soul.


It Isn’t A Sin To Be Tempted
It isn’t a sin to be tempted; it is only a sin if you yield to the temptation.
